Martial Arts Tournament Thriller THE TRIGONAL Teases Justice By Design In The Official Trailer
EXCLUSIVE: The bustling career path faced by actor, martial artist and filmmaker Vincent Soberano is one that seems to have been continually ripe at nearly every turn in the past two years. Several films completed in his wake and with more in tow with partnerships currently in bloom, he is well on his way into the summer film festival season with a momentous brand that moviegoers and action fans will be very keen on in the coming months if not already.
Further details are still pending following the news we broke last month for upcoming thriller, No Man’s Waters and romantic action comedy, Three Poles, but keep these titles in mind as we now look toward the forthcoming release of Soberano’s new tournament action thriller, The Trigonal. Actor and martial artist Ian Ignacio leads the film among a raft of screen talents comprising the story of a retired martial arts champion forced to step in the ring once more when his wife and best friend fall victim to the wills of an international crime syndicate invaded his small idyllic town to launch an illegal underground fighting circuit.
The film’s campaign has been on a slow and steady rollout with at least six mini-teasers introducing our cast of characters which also include actress Rhian Ramos, actor Christian Vazquez, and multi-faceted actress Sarah Chang who also serves as the film’s fight choreographer; also starring are Levi Ignacio and Monsour Del Rosario, along with UFC contender Li JingLiang, Leigh Guda, Wu Pei Xu, Jakab Goldin and Australian actor Paul Allica. As of early Monday at 10am (Manila time), Film Combat Syndicate is more than pleased to present an exclusive look at the official trailer while Soberano and his team at Cinefenio proudly gear up for a Cannes premiere on May 9 ahead of its release in the Philippines.

TAPADO: FIGHT FOR JUSTICE: Filming Starts On Vincent Soberano’s New FMA Action Drama
The film’s title itself is a word that stems from stick fighting in Filipino martial arts, one that no less speaks highly to Soberano’s contined goal of bringing FMA to the forefront of action by next year as there are already a few films brewing in the action genre in the region. Headlining are Soberano in reunion with several Blood Hunters cast, including actor Ian Ignacio for a story centered on a downtrodden MMA champion who journeys into the world of underground fighting to take down an elusive drug lord.

Help Robin Hood And His Ragtag Team Of Legendary Badasses Get Medieval For THE SIEGE!
You’re forgiven for being a little apprehensive when you’re introduced to a film that promises Raid-like expectations. Some titles make the cut while others fall may short, and nowadays you’ll find lead actor and producer Paul Allica lending his own effort to measure with the new period action thriller, The Siege.
This one promises a story featuring an assortment of notable medieval heroes and Arthurian legends led by the English folkloric outlaw himself, Robin Hood, as they descend unto a castle dead set on hunting down the sheriff of Nottingham. The concept further bolsters an Expendables-style feel by way of A Knight’s Tale and other medieval tropes therein for a bold production hopefully starting later this year.
After the brutal murder of his mother at the hand of the Sheriff of Nottingham, Robin Hood vows revenge. However, this is not a fight he can win alone – first he must learn to fight with and trust others.
Advised and mentored by the reclusive mystic, Merlin, Robin gathers a team of outcasts, mavericks and fugitives, each of whom holds a grudge and an extreme skill to help bring down the tyrannical sheriff.
Working together they rally the dispirited villagers to prepare for an assault on the castle The Sheriff of Nottingham shelters in.
The Siege combines adventure, thrills and even a touch of romance in a non-stop action story that will excite and entertain in equal measure.
